#4 The Undertaker gets personal with AJ Styles (WWE RAW)

As fans of WWE, many would agree that watching legends suffer inside the ring is one of the worst sights in the business. It destroys the legacy that they have crafted over the years. The same was happening with The Undertaker, and he finally got a chance to bid farewell to WWE this year on his own terms, after competing in a memorable match against AJ Styles.

The Undertaker wanted to face AJ Styles in his last WWE match, and the two started feuding in the weeks leading up to WrestleMania. The Phenomenal One took things a little too far when he started bad-mouthing Undertaker’s wife and former WWE Superstar, Michelle McCool. An irked ‘Taker then returned as The American Badass and decided to school Styles.

Undertaker, who is known for maintaining the kayfabe for all these years, broke his character and directed his promo at Styles’ real name instead. The Phenom made it clear that Styles has crossed a line, and the latter would be punished accordingly. It was a compelling promo that set the stage for the Boneyard Match at WWE WrestleMania.

It was clear that The Undertaker was disheartened after seeing his performance over the last few years. He wanted to make the most of his opportunity and poured his raw emotions into this promo. Styles also deserves a lot of credit for helping The Undertaker throughout this feud that finally ended with arguably the best cinematic match in WWE history. Styles accused Michelle McCool of buying The Undertaker’s career. At WrestleMania, The Deadman buried Styles (literally) before driving off to sunset. Now, who doesn’t love a good irony?
